America's Video Game Expo 2008

Press Release PROVIDED BY GAMES PRESS

Lunar Tide Communications, Inc., co-producers of America's Video Game Expo (VGXPO), one of the largest consumer gaming events in the America's, is expanding the scope of VGXPO to include a new game industry conference – the 'East Coast Games Summit'. Designed to serve the professional colleagues in the game industry, as well as those interested in starting a career in games, the Summit offers programming for all VGXPO attendees.

Co-sponsored by GameJobs.com and GameRecruiter, the East Coast Games Summit is an industry conference that supports a range of programming and networking opportunities. Summit tracks include: "Scrum Deconstructed," a hands-on workshop for game industry management and technologists; 'Breaking In' a single-track mini-conference for students and others interested in making a career out of games; 'Pitch You Game Idea' , a session for would-be game entrepreneurs to present their game concepts to game industry leaders; and a number of additional keynotes and panel sessions on hot topics in the game industry.

The East Coast Games Summit will include speakers representing a number of leading companies, organizations and educational institutions from within the game industry, including: Acclaim Entertainment, Electronic Arts, Bioware, Nexon, Red Storm Entertainment, Viximo, Zeitgeist Games, Obsidian Entertainment, International Game Developers Association (IGDA), Entertainment Software Association (ESA), Entertainment Consumer Association (ECA), Full Sail, ITT Tech, The Art Institutes, SMU Guild Hall, Devry University, Savannah College of Art and Design and the Vancouver Film School.

"The East Coast Games Summit provides hands-on experience on important topics in the games industry," said David Perry, CCO of Acclaim Entertainment. "Whether you are managing developers, designing video games or looking for career opportunities, this summit provides something for everyone."

To kick off the inaugural year of the East Coast Games Summit, all conference tracks are offered at no expense to registered VGXPO attendees. In addition, all game industry trade members whom wish to participate in VGXPO and the East Coast Games Summit are encouraged to submit their credentials prior to Oct .10 for a free Industry Insider pass to VGXPO.

America's Video Game Expo (VGXPO) and the East Coast Games Summit will be held November 21 – 23, 2008 at the Pennsylvania Convention Center, in Philadelphia, PA. For more information about the events, or to register, please visit www.videogame.net
